Vancouver Tree Lighting - December 9, 2011

The fifth annual Vancouver Tree Lighting event will be held at the Jack Poole Plaza at the Convention Centre on Friday, December 9, 2011 from 5:30 p.m. to 7:00 p.m.

This free community event is the largest tree lighting ceremony in Western Canada, with the 50-foot Shaw Holiday Tree that will stand lit until after New Years. Performers will include Aliqua, the Vancouver’s Children’s Choir, Christmas soloists and special guest appearances by the BC Lions along with the Felions and Bro Jake from Rock 101. Rick Hansen will light the tree around 6:55 p.m. Don’t miss this local tradition.

Schedule

5:30 p.m.: The celebration begins! Bring the family to Jack Poole Plaza at the Convention Centre

5:45 p.m.: Vancouver Children’s Choir will be performing some favourite Christmas carols

6:00 p.m.: Santa Claus arrives

6:05 p.m.: Isabella De Cotiis sings

6:12 p.m.: Vancouver Children’s Choir will share more holiday songs

6:24 p.m.: Patrick Hewson sings

6:34 p.m.: Acappella group Aliqua performs

6:38 p.m.: Rick Hansen will come on stage to get ready for the lighting

6:55 p.m.: The countdown begins to the tree lighting!
